fix(logScale): (1) Thoroughly resolve a long-standing issue of non-positive data on LogScale - exclude non-positive series data items when calculate dataExtent on LogScale. (2) Include Infinite into connectNulls handling on line series; the Infinite value may be generated by log(0) and previously the corresponding effect in unpredictable on line series (sometimes display as connected but sometimes not).
